Exploring the distinctive visual style of the samurai, the photobook Japanese Samurai Fashion presents a focused study on traditional attire and its cultural resonance. The images reveal intricate details of the garments that define the samurai identity, emphasizing craftsmanship and historical significance.
The photographic approach highlights textures, patterns, and layering in the samurai clothing, capturing the tension between utilitarian function and ceremonial elegance. Through its examination of festivals and cultural ceremonies, the book situates samurai fashion within a living tradition, offering insight into the ongoing relevance of these sartorial forms.
